  • More than 90% of the alcohol consumed by people among the ages of 12 to 20 years of age in the United States is consumed in the form of binge drinks.
  • A study of 18- to 24-year-old current drinkers who failed to complete high school showed that nearly 60 percent had begun to consume alcohol before age 16.
  • Alcohol use among adolescents can be linked with considering, planning, attempting, and completing suicide.
  • A small percentage don't reduce their drinking at all during pregnancy, suggesting they are dependent on alcohol and that intense intervention and treatment may be necessary in order to reduce the harm to their babies.
